Hi!! I just have a quick question... I have a Journey HD brake controller installed on my 2002 dodge pickup. The other night I realized that my rear brake light seems to be flashing at the oddest of times... when my truck is off, in the middle of the night, ect. Today, I went to go look at it, and on the brake controller the code is C5, which is continually flashing... what does that mean? Thank you for the help!!! -James
asked by: James S
Expert Reply:
The CS error code on your Journey HD Brake Controller indicates a Charging System Error - There may be a charging system problem or an inadequate connection to the tow vehicle’s battery. The unit will reset once the situation is corrected. Check the connection between the controller and the wiring adapter, and the connection between the adapter and the brake controller port under the dash. Make sure everything is tightly connected. Check the fuse in the block under the hood that powers the brake controller, making sure that it is good, and is firmly connected.
